What this study is about

From the age of 50 onwards, there is a disproportionate decline in muscle strength, mass and function, which can be prevented or at least delayed by physical training. Unfortunately, many training programmes are very time-consuming and strenuous and are therefore not carried out consistently. Whole-body electromyostimulation (WB-EMS), a technology in which all major muscle groups are stimulated with an adjusted stimulation level, could be a time-effective and joint-friendly alternative. However, there are some contraindications to the widespread use of this technology, which are particularly common in middle-aged and elderly people. For example, high blood pressure, which affects more than half of men over the age of 50 in Germany, is considered a contraindication for WB-EMS training. However, this assessment is not very reliable; at least, acute WB-EMS application does not lead to an increase in blood pressure. In addition, there are no study results available for long-term WB-EMS application in people with high blood pressure. The present study particularly investigate whether and to what extent several weeks of WB-EMS training has an effect on resting blood pressure in people with mild blood pressure. Additionally, the effect of WB-EMS on other cardiometabolic risk factors and physical function will be addressed.

Basic eligibility

Age50 Years to 70 Years
SexMale
Healthy volunteersNot accepted
ConditionHypertension, Metabolic Syndrome, Hypercholesterolemia, Hypertriglyceridemia, Overweight and Obesity

Full registry criteria

Inclusion Criteria: * Grade 1 hypertension: systolic 140 and/or diastolic 90 mmHg * overweight or obese (body mass index \> 25 kg/m2) Exclusion Criteria: * blood pressure-lowering pharmacologic therapy. * WB-EMS application and regular resistance exercise training * Conditions and illnesses that preclude intensive physical exertion * Severe cardiac arrhythmia * Heart failure * acute pulmonary embolism * acute myocarditis * severe hypertension, e.g. blood pressure \> 200 mmHg systolic and/or \>110 mmHg diastolic * Contraindications for bioimpedance analysis (e.g. pacemaker) * Contraindications for WB-EMS application (e.g. acute infections/fever, epilepsy)

Treatments and study arms

WB-EMS

Other

12 weeks of WB-EMS, 1.5x20 min/week

Control

Other

12 weeks without additional intervention and without life style changes

Primary outcomes

Resting blood pressureAt baseline and after 12 weeks of intervention

Changes of mean arterial blood pressure after 10 min of rest in a sitting position as assessed by an automatic sphygmomanometer

Metabolic syndromeAt baseline and after 12 weeks of intervention

Changes of the Metabolic Syndrome (MetS) as determined by the MetS-Z-Score
